About the author

Clients in the Fortune 50 and across the globe trust Scott K. Edinger as their premier consultant for leading business growth. Scott has worked with CEOs and senior leaders to develop pragmatic strategies and execute approaches to drive top- and bottom-line results. He has written three books and over a hundred articles in Forbes and Harvard Business Review, among other prominent publications.

As a consultant, author, advisor, and speaker, Scott creates positive change for clients and is recognized as an expert in the intersection of leadership, strategy, and sales.

He is the best-selling author of The Growth Leader: Strategies to Drive the Top and Bottom Lines (Fast Company Press, 2023), as well as co-author of The Hidden Leader: Discover and Develop Greatness Within Your Company (AMACOM, 2015) and The Inspiring Leader: Unlocking the Secrets of How Extraordinary Leaders Motivate (McGraw Hill, 2009). His Harvard Business Review article "Making Yourself Indispensable" has been called a "classic in the making." Scott's work has been published in the HBR Guide to Your Professional Growth and the HBR Guide to Being More Productive.

Scott has served as an affiliate faculty member for the University of North Carolina, Kenan-Flagler Business School. He received a BS in communication studies and rhetoric from Florida State University, where he sat on alumni committees including the Board of the College of Communication and Information, as well as the Seminole Torchbearers.

An extensive traveler and avid football fan, Scott prioritizes experiences above all. He has bungee-jumped into a New Zealand canyon, supported his Seminoles at six national championship games, and performed with the Mormon Tabernacle Choir (despite not sharing their religious affiliation or ability to read music). He and his family live in Tampa, Florida.
